Remarks, etc.

•When you turn on the Movie Camera on while a

Video Cassette is already inside, the “READ”

Indication initially appears in the Viewfinder while it
reads the VITC address of the last recorded scene
from the Video Cassette. After a short moment, the
Movie Camera then switches over to the recording

Pause Mode and the "PAUSE” Indication appears,

•The “READ” Indication also appears in the Viewfinder

when you switch over from the "VTR” mode to the

"CAMERA” mode by pressing the [VTR/CAMERA]
Button and exchange a Video Cassette.

■ Ejecting the Video Cassette

After you have stopped recording, slide the [EJECT

A]

Lever to the right. The Cassette Compartment Cover

opens after a few seconds and you can then take out
the Video Cassette.

•It is not possible to take out the video cassette during

recording,

•Do not repeatedly insert and take out the Video

Cassette. This could cause the tape to become loose
and damaged.
